    Matt don't listen to the all knowing dbs on this site that criticize anyone new that asks a question or is trying to learn. Sure you can just post an iso but if it is off then they will crap on ur thread there too. One tip would be bouncing off your trade ideas with an experienced trader you have a relationship with before posting to see if it is on target or fair. That is what I did and continue to do with people like Grumpy, Jbuddle, and cheepbeerbuzz. Hope this helps and good luck.
